While need and needed are closely related words, they have distinct meanings and uses. need is used to express a current or ongoing requirement, while needed indicates that a requirement existed in the past. Need is a derived term of needed. as verbs the difference between needed and need is that needed is past tense of need while need is to be necessary (to someone). as an adjective needed is necessary; being needed. as a noun need is a requirement for something. We can use main verb need as an alternative to semi modal need. main verb need is followed by to and it changes with person, number and tense (i, you, we, they need to; she, he, it needs to; i, you, she, he, it, we, they needed to). ….
